sañjaya uvāca | te tu bhīṣmaṃ samāsādya ṛṣayo haṃsarūpiṇaḥ | apaśyañ charatalpasthaṃ bhīṣmaṃ kurukulodvaham ||
Sañjaya said: Those sages, assuming the form of swans, approached Bhīṣma and beheld him—Kuru lineage’s foremost bearer—lying upon his bed of arrows.
